(2) Data replacement mode In the data replacement mode, the system replaces reference data stored in the ROM area with the new instead of correcting the data reference instruction when that reference data is changed. The program jump mode reduces the complexity of correcting the processing routine. However, when this mode is used, if there is a need to replace only the fixed data in ROM, the instruction to reference this ROM data should be corrected. Thus, a large amount of ROM is required for the patch program. To avoid this, the system has the data replacement mode. With this mode, three consecutive bytes of data can be replaced for each bank. (For an instruction which accesses only one byte, only the first byte can be replaced. For an instruction which accesses only two bytes, the two consecutive bytes can be replaced.) Setting ROMCCR CMx (x: 0 to 3) to “1” puts the system in the data replacement mode. Specify the start address of ROM data to be replaced as the corrective ROM address. Then, specify the new three-byte data as the patch data. Note: For data replacement mode, the corrective address should be the address of fixed data (including a vector). (The operation code and operand cannot be changed.) Example 1: Setting the program correction circuit with the initial routine Using the initial routine program, which is executed right after reset, set the program correction circuit's register as follows. 1. Read the flag, which indicates whether to use the program correction circuit, from the external memory. 2. If that circuit is not used, perform normal initial processing. 3. If it is used, set CMx to “1” to establish the data replacement mode. 4. Read the address of the data to be replaced and the patch data from the external memory. 5. Set the address and patch data, which were read in step “4.”, in ROMCDR. 6. Repeat steps “4.” and “5.” as many times as there are required banks.
